Abstract
Plasma treatment changes the outermost layer of a material without interfering with the bulk properties. However, textiles are several millimeters thick and need to be treated homogeneously throughout the entire thickness. In this paper, the dielectric-barrier-discharge treatment in He of three different textile layers is studied for several medium pressure values, and images of the discharge footprints are presented to demonstrate the pressure effect on plasma penetration.
